Output 85a9b3663072d7cbe0ef5ab7aa85ab5a59ca788adb0a58cff7632b8b1f15937a:0

value
172755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8b139e049787a847943f724aee59814153480d OP_EQUAL
address
32vdKFXJPsXUSkQnMfP34rvgCXRB3fcCxj
transaction
85a9b3663072d7cbe0ef5ab7aa85ab5a59ca788adb0a58cff7632b8b1f15937a
spent
true